How Skip Lockwood's Starts Compares to Similar Players
Skip Lockwood totaled 106 career Starts, near the starting pitcher average of 103.8 — a profile that tracked closely with league norms. His best Starts season came in 1971, posting 32, well above the starting pitcher average of 18.2 that year. The lowest point came in 1975 at 0, well below the starting pitcher average of 19.0 that year. Output was consistent through the final seasons.
